Liza Minnelli’s Memoir and Reflections

Liza Minnelli, the iconic daughter of Hollywood legends Judy Garland and Vincente Minnelli, has recently released her memoir titled ‘Kids, Wait Till You Hear This!’. At 79 years old, Minnelli recounts her extensive career in show business, sharing personal anecdotes and professional moments that have shaped her life.

In her memoir, Minnelli reflects on her experiences with various Hollywood figures, including a candid description of her time working with Gene Hackman during the filming of ‘Lucky Lady’ in 1975. She describes Hackman as “downright rude,” a sentiment echoed by director Stanley Donen, who noted that Hackman was very dismissive of her during the production. This revelation comes as the film marks its 50th anniversary, highlighting the complexities of on-set relationships in the entertainment industry.

Gene Hackman, who passed away in February 2025 at the age of 95, is just one of the many notable figures Minnelli discusses in her memoir. The book also touches on her tumultuous fourth marriage to David Gest, which she describes as “traumatising.” These personal revelations provide insight into the challenges she faced, both professionally and personally, throughout her life.

In addition to her reflections on past relationships, Minnelli’s memoir includes claims about her affairs with renowned personalities such as Peter Sellers and Martin Scorsese. These revelations offer a glimpse into the private life of a woman who has often been in the public eye, further emphasizing her status as what she has referred to as the “original nepo baby.”

Despite the challenges she has faced, Minnelli remains a celebrated performer. Her recent performance alongside Lady Gaga at the 2022 Oscars showcased her enduring talent and charisma. The collaboration was a testament to her ability to connect with new generations of artists, reinforcing her legacy in the entertainment world.

As Minnelli approaches her 80th birthday, she reflects on her life with a mix of nostalgia and resilience. She has previously expressed fears about not living past the age of 47, the age at which her mother, Judy Garland, passed away.
